FIU men’s basketball announced on May 9 the signing of Andreas Holst, a 7-foot forward from Copenhagen, Denmark, who transferred from Oklahoma. Holst redshirted last season with the Sooners.
The addition of Holst is significant for FIU as he brings international and collegiate experience to the team. He was rated as a three-star recruit by On3 and Rivals and ranked 131st nationally in the 2025 class. According to On3, he was also listed as the No. 33 power forward in his class.
Holst previously played for Denmark’s Bakken Bears in Basketligean, which is Denmark’s top professional league. During his time there, he made 38 three-pointers for Bakken. He also represented Denmark at the 2023 FIBA U18 European Championship where he averaged 8.9 points, 2.6 rebounds, and 1.4 blocks over seven games.
In addition to his international play, Holst averaged 9.3 points and 3.4 rebounds across 23 games with Bears Academy—a Bakken Bears affiliate—and participated in NBA Academy Games held in the United States.
Holst becomes only the second Panther from Denmark after Kasper Christiansen (2017-18) and is FIU’s first seven-footer since Seth Pinkney played during the 2023-24 season.
